In 1993 (40 years after my parents were killed) there was a mock trial put
on by the American Bar Association with a real federal judge, teams of
cracker-jack lawyers, actors playing the witnesses and two seven-per NY
juries).  The lawyers defending my parents were able to prove the perjuries
of prosecution witnesses at the original trial based on information gleaned
by researchers since 1953 and both NY juries found my parents innocent --

The NY times did not cover it ---- My brother was on vacation and when he
saw that the NY times had no report on the "juries' " verdicts he told his
wife --_ WE WON --- which they then confirmed by reading the Boston Globe.

Later that summer, the Times ran an article about the vindication of an
alleged cattle rustler in California who was hanged ---
